Extracorporeal photopheresis for chronic graft-versus-host disease: a systematic review and meta-analysis
BACKGROUND The safety of extracorporeal photopheresis (ECP) in steroid-refractory chronic graft-versus-host disease (SR-cGVHD) has been explored in multiple studies but reported response rates (RR) vary significantly across studies. متن کاملCrystallization of a Keplerate-type polyoxometalate into a superposed kagome-lattice with huge channels.
Crystal structures of two Sr(2+) salts of the Keplerate-type polyoxometalate, [Mo(VI)(72)Mo(V)(60)O(372)(CH(3)COO)(30)(H(2)O)(72)](42-), have been determined by single crystal X-ray diffraction. متن کاملFreeze Fracture of Skeletal Muscle from the Tarantula Spider
The structure of the membranes of sarcoplasmic reticulum (SR), tubular (T) system, and sarcolemma has been studied by freeze fracture in leg muscles of the Tarantula spider. Two regions of the sarcoplasmic reticulum can be differentiated by the distribution of particles on the fracture faces: a junctional SR, at the dyads, and a longitudinal SR, elsewhere. متن کاملLamellar Junctional Sarcoplasmic Reticulum
This report deals with a description of an assembly of lamellar structures that have a morphology indistinguishable from that of cardiac junctional (1) and extended junctional (2) sarcoplasmic reticulum (SR). متن کاملSpheroidal Bodies in the Junctional Sarcoplasmic Reticulum of Lizard Myocardial Cells
The sarcoplasmic reticulum (SR) of lizard (Anolis carolinensis) myocardial cells has been examined, with particular attention being paid to the structural details of the peripheral couplings (junctional SR).
